Straight Hands vs. Curved Hands
Many palm readers believe that even the shape of your palm can reveal aspects of your personality.
Straight Hands: People with straighter palms are often described as practical, logical, and disciplined. They are said to make decisions with their head rather than their heart.
Curved Hands: In contrast, curved or slightly bent palms are linked with creativity, emotional depth, and artistic talent. Such individuals are thought to rely more on intuition and feelings.
While these interpretations may sound appealing, the truth is that there’s no scientific proof that palm shapes determine success or destiny. At best, they may reflect subtle differences in personality or how we view ourselves.

Global Beliefs About Palm Lines
The fascination with palmistry isn’t confined to one region—it stretches across the world.
Europe: In European culture, palmistry was often practiced during the Renaissance. It was seen more as a way to understand a person’s character rather than predict their exact future.
America: In the United States today, palm reading is usually considered a form of entertainment. Some people view it as part of life-coaching or self-discovery, while others dismiss it as a party trick.
Asia (India, Pakistan, China): Palmistry has deep roots in Asian traditions. In India and Pakistan, people often associate palm lines with marriage, wealth, or health predictions. In China, hand lines are sometimes connected with balance, energy, and destiny.
Spiritual Perspective (Islam): Islam clearly states that knowledge of the unseen (the future) belongs only to God. Palm lines cannot predict destiny, although cultural beliefs sometimes mix religion with tradition.

The Science Behind Palm Lines
So, what does science say about those mysterious lines?
Palm lines, or palmar creases, form while a baby is still developing in the womb. They are a result of genetics and the natural folding of the skin as the hand grows.
Everyone has unique palm lines, much like fingerprints. They are determined by biology—not destiny.
In medicine, certain palm line patterns can sometimes help doctors detect genetic conditions, such as Down syndrome. This shows that palm lines can be medically significant, but not for predicting love, money, or success.
In short, palm lines reflect biology, not prophecy.

Why Do People Still Believe in Palmistry?
Even if science dismisses palmistry, millions still believe in it. Why?
Hope: People want reassurance about their future, especially during uncertain times.
Curiosity: Palmistry is mysterious and intriguing, sparking conversations and self-reflection.
Cultural Tradition: For many, palm reading is passed down through generations, making it more about heritage than truth.
Palmistry survives not because it predicts the future, but because it satisfies human imagination.
